Atlas Cloud を使って Cursor で KAT Coder を無料で利用する方法
KAT Coder は Kuaishou の Kwaipilot チームによって開発された、現在利用可能な最も強力な AI コーディングモデルの 1 つであり、機能実装、デバッグ、リファクタリング、長文脈コード理解といった実際のソフトウェアエンジニアリングタスクに優れています。
一番の利点は?
数多くの人気 AI 搭載コードエディターの 1 つである Cursor 内で KAT Coder を無料で利用できる ようになりました。これは、統合 AI モデル API プラットフォームである Atlas Cloud に接続することで実現します。
このガイドでは、追加のインフラストラクチャやコストの壁なしに、KAT Coder Pro および KAT Coder Exp-72B-1010 を Cursor に統合する方法を ステップバイステップ で解説します。
Cursor で KAT Coder を利用する理由
Cursor は、IDE と AI の緊密なワークフローで既に開発者に愛されています。これを KAT Coder と組み合わせることで、次世代のコーディング体験がアンロックされます。
KAT Coder の特徴
KAT Coder は単なるコード補完モデルではありません。これは エージェント型ソフトウェアエンジニアリング のために構築されています。
- ✅ 実際の GitHub イシュー(SWE-Bench 認証済み)での強力なパフォーマンス
- ✅ 長文脈の理解(ファイル全体、モジュール、リポジトリ)
- ✅ デバッグ、リファクタリング、複数ステップのタスクに優れている
- ✅ ジュニアエンジニアのように推論、計画、実行できるように設計されている
Cursor の UI と組み合わせることで、コードベースを実際に理解する AI コーディングコパイロット を入手できます。
KAT Coder を利用する最も簡単な方法:Atlas Cloud
Atlas Cloud は、KAT Coder を含む 主要な AI モデルに無料でアクセスできる、統合された OpenAI 互換 API を提供します。
開発者向けの主なメリット
- 🔑 OpenAI 互換 API (Cursor とシームレスに連携)
- 💸 KAT Coder モデルの無料の入出力
- ⚡ 低遅延、本番対応インフラストラクチャ
- 🔁 簡単なモデル切り替え(Pro / Exp-72B)
- 🌍 ベンダーロックインなし
利用可能なモデル:
- text
1kwaipilot/kat-coder-pro - text
1kwaipilot/kat-coder-exp-72b-1010
ステップ 1: Atlas Cloud API キーを取得する
- Atlas Cloud にアクセスします
- サインアップまたはログインします
- API キーを作成します
- 安全に保存します(Cursor で必要になります)
このキーは OpenAI API キーと同様に使用できますが、Atlas Cloud のベース URL を使用します。
ステップ 2: Cursor を Atlas Cloud に接続するように設定する
Cursor はカスタムの OpenAI 互換エンドポイントを接続できます。
Cursor の設定
- Cursor を開きます
- Settings → Models / OpenAI に移動します
- 以下を設定します:
API Key
plaintext1ATLASCLOUD_API_KEY
Base URL
plaintext1https://api.atlascloud.ai/v1
これで、Cursor はすべての AI リクエストを Atlas Cloud 経由でルーティングするようになります。
ステップ 3: Cursor で KAT Coder をモデルとして選択する
Cursor のモデルセレクター(または設定)で、以下のいずれかを選択します:
-
KAT Coder Pro
plaintext1kwaipilot/kat-coder-pro -
KAT Coder Exp-72B-1010 (高度なタスク / 長文脈タスク用)
plaintext1kwaipilot/kat-coder-exp-72b-1010
これで完了です。追加の設定は不要です。
Cursor が KAT Coder と通信する仕組み(裏側)
Cursor は OpenAI スタイルのクライアントを使用します。Atlas Cloud は完全に互換性があります。
リクエストがどのようにルーティングされるかを示す参考 Python コードはこちらです:
python1import os 2from openai import OpenAI 3 4client = OpenAI( 5 api_key=os.getenv("ATLASCLOUD_API_KEY"), 6 base_url="https://api.atlascloud.ai/v1" 7) 8 9response = client.chat.completions.create( 10 model="kwaipilot/kat-coder-pro", 11 messages=[ 12 {"role": "user", "content": "Refactor this Python function to be more readable"} 13 ], 14 max_tokens=800 15) 16 17print(response.choices[0].message["content"])
Cursor は内部でこれと同様のことを行っています。あなたは上に美しいエディター UI を利用するだけです。
Cursor 内での最適なユースケース
接続後、KAT Coder は Cursor ワークフローで次のように輝きます:
🧠 ファイル全体のリファクタリング
「このファイルを最新の TypeScript ベストプラクティスに従うようにリファクタリングしてください。」
🐞 詳細なデバッグ
「この非同期関数が時々デッドロックするのはなぜですか?」
🔄 マイグレーションタスク
「この React クラスコンポーネントを hooks に変換してください。」
🧪 テスト生成
「このサービスのエッジケースを考慮した単体テストを作成してください。」
📦 リポジトリレベルの推論
「これらのモジュールがどのように連携するか説明し、改善案を提案してください。」
Exp-72B モデルは、特に大きなファイルや複数ファイルにまたがるコンテキストに強力です。
最良の結果を得るためのプロのヒント
Cursor で KAT Coder を最大限に活用するために:
- 明確なタスク指示を含める
- 正確なファイルまたは関数をハイライトする
- フォローアッププロンプトを使用する(「次にパフォーマンスを最適化してください」「テストを追加してください」)
- コンテキストサイズに応じて Pro と Exp-72B を切り替える
インディー開発者とチームに最適なセットアップ
| 機能 | Cursor + Atlas Cloud |
|---|---|
| AI コーディング | ✅ KAT Coder |
| コスト | ✅ 無料 |
| セットアップ時間 | ✅ 5 分 |
| API 互換性 | ✅ OpenAI スタイル |
| 本番対応 | ✅ はい |
これにより、Atlas Cloud + Cursor は、現在利用可能な最高の無料 AI コーディングスタックの 1 つとなります。
Cursor で KAT Coder を使ってコーディングを開始 — 無料
高額なサブスクリプションや期間限定トライアルを待つ必要はありません。
Atlas Cloud を使用すると、以下が可能です:
- 日常的なコーディングに KAT Coder Pro を使用する
- KAT Coder Exp-72B-1010 を試す
- お気に入りの AI エディター Cursor 内に留まる
- 開始にあたり 無料 です
👉 モデル:

